About Babanuang

Within San Manuel's barangay network in Pangasinan, Babanuang is a mid-range residential area. The barangay reflects a typical residential development pattern — houses fronting barangay roads, with sari-sari stores and small home-based businesses along the main access route. Flood risk in this part of San Manuel is moderate — buyers should verify the specific lot's drainage conditions. The residential market in Babanuang is primarily owner-occupied. single-family homes, townhouses, and affordable condominiums are available, catering to local families and employed workers looking for permanent, practical homes. Buyers should budget for standard transfer taxes, documentary stamp tax, and registration fees on top of the purchase price.

Flood Risk

Moderate Flood Risk

Flood risk in Babanuang is moderate, consistent with San Manuel's overall profile. Parts of the barangay may accumulate water during strong rainfall, but full inundation is not the norm. Buyers should ask neighbors about their street's specific flood history and verify the property's elevation relative to nearby drainage canals.

Transport

Babanuang relies on San Manuel's local transport system. Tricycles serve the barangay-level routes; jeepneys and multicabs link residents to San Manuel's commercial district, public schools, and government offices. Buyers who commute daily to an employment center outside San Manuel should evaluate the nearest bus or P2P terminal for their specific route.

Amenities

Babanuang maintains barangay-level services: health center, multi-purpose hall, and elementary school. The nearest public market, district hospital, high schools, and commercial centers are in San Manuel proper — the standard amenity pattern for barangays in this province.

Growth Potential

Buyers in Babanuang are entering a mature, stable market. San Manuel's economic base sustains consistent residential demand. Capital appreciation is moderate but dependable over a 10-year horizon — more predictable than emerging markets, though without the same upside potential.
